New Delhi, Oct 26 (KNN) The Confederation of All India Traders (CAIT) in a communication sent to Prime Minister Narendra Modi today has suggested that in order to keep alive the remembrance of Shri Atal Bihari Vajpayee, the Rajpath Road in Delhi should be renamed as "Atal Bihari Vajpayee Path".
According to a press release, CAIT National Secretary General Praveen Khandelwal in his communication to Prime Minister has also suggested that a tall statute of Vajpayee may be erected at Vijay Chowk in Delhi near Parliament.
Khandelwal also suggested that the Golden Quadrilateral Highway Network should also be named as Atal Behari Vajpayee Rashtriya Rajmarg. The Golden Quadrilateral Highway Network was the brainchild of Shri Vajpayee to connect the entire Country. If this project is named after him, it will be a true tribute to a person who saw the dream of connecting India with Highways.
The CAIT has sent copies of the letter addressed to Prime Minister to Minister for Transport & Highways Nitin Gadkari and Union Urban Development Minister Hardeep Puri for necessary action.
